A typical day for a traditional Indian woman often begins before sunrise. These early hours are sacred—dedicated to prayer ( puja ), rangoli (artistic patterns made of colored powders at the doorstep), and the preparation of fresh meals. The kitchen is considered the heart of the home, and food is viewed not just as nutrition but as Prasad (blessed offering). Spices like turmeric and cumin are used as much for their Ayurvedic medicinal properties as for flavor.

At the heart of the traditional Indian woman’s lifestyle lies the concept of “Grihasti” (household life). For centuries, a woman’s identity was primarily defined by her roles within the domestic sphere: a daughter, a wife, and a mother. The culture emphasizes “Pativrata” (devotion to husband) and “Matri Shakti” (the power of motherhood). Her daily routine typically begins before sunrise with prayer ( puja ), followed by the meticulous preparation of meals, cleaning, and the care of children and elders. Festivals like Karva Chauth (a fast for the husband’s long life) or Teej are not merely rituals but cultural cornerstones that reinforce these values. Sarees, bangles, and the bindi (vermilion mark) are more than fashion; they are cultural symbols of marital status and regional identity. In rural India, this lifestyle also includes immense physical labor—fetching water, tending cattle, and working in fields—often without formal recognition or financial compensation.
